The new New Balance Philippines Ad says it all. (I hope SFrunner reads this)

"New Balance Philippines launched yesterday its new brand campaign which highlights running as the heart of all sports and spotlights the complex love/hate relationship of people with running.

The new ad campaign brings out the challenges and obstacles of people with running, through the personification of running, and showcases how New Balance can help the relationship between a runner and running to decrease the hate and to tip more to love...

The love/hate campaign was formulated through a global study of different runners of different nationalities. The study revealed that runners all have the same sentiments when it comes to running; they feel euphoric when running but they need to get past the struggles before they feel good about it..."
----Philippine Star, July 16, 2008
